Python vs Java: Which One to Choose?
Many beginners often compare Python vs Java to decide which programming language to learn first. While Java is known for its performance and scalability, Python excels in simplicity and ease of use. If you want quick development with fewer lines of code, Python is the best choice.
Python for Data Science
Python is a dominant language in the field of data science. Libraries like Pandas, NumPy, and Matplotlib make it easy to manipulate and visualize data. If you’re interested in Python for data science, mastering these libraries is essential. Python is also widely used in AI and machine learning, thanks to frameworks like TensorFlow and Scikit-Learn.

Popular Python Libraries
Python’s strength lies in its extensive libraries that enhance its capabilities. Some of the most commonly used Python libraries include:
- Django & Flask (for web development)
- Pandas & NumPy (for data analysis)
- Matplotlib & Seaborn (for data visualization)
- Scikit-learn & TensorFlow (for machine learning)
Learning these libraries will help you work efficiently on different projects.
Python Projects to Practice
The best way to master Python is by working on real-world Python projects. Here are some ideas:
- Web Scraper: Extract data from websites using BeautifulSoup.
- Chatbot: Build a simple chatbot using AI.
- Data Visualization Dashboard: Create interactive charts with Matplotlib.
- Automated Email Sender: Write a Python script to send emails automatically.

Python Multiline Comment
In Python programming, developers use multiline comments to document code over multiple lines, enhancing readability and organization. Unlike single-line comments, which use the #
symbol, multiline comments are enclosed in triple quotes ('''
or """
). This method allows developers to write detailed explanations or notes without interrupting the code flow. Python multiline comment are especially useful for explaining complex logic or providing instructions within the code. Although Python does not have a dedicated multiline comment syntax, using triple quotes serves as an effective way to include extensive comments and keep code maintainable.
Mastering Excel Formulas for Efficiency
Excel formulas are essential tools for performing calculations, analyzing data, and automating tasks within spreadsheets. Common Excel formulas like SUM, AVERAGE, IF, and VLOOKUP allow users to handle large datasets with ease. By mastering these formulas, you can perform complex mathematical operations, logical comparisons, and data lookups, all while saving time. Excel formulas simplify data management and improve accuracy, making them a must-have skill for professionals in finance, business, and data analysis. Whether for basic calculations or advanced modeling, learning Excel formulas is key to boosting productivity and enhancing your spreadsheet efficiency.
